Description
Specifies the video profile and level of the wrapped video codec which is used to define the complexity of the codec.
Definition
Used in Checks, the system shall read out the profile and level indicated in the wrapper metadata and check if it matches the expected one specified in the input. Optionally, the system may report the profile and level.

Used in Reports, the system shall read out the profile and level indicated in the wrapper metadata and report it.

This Test is a readout Test.

Related SMPTE Universal Labels:
060e2b34.01010105.04010602.010a0000 [profile and level, ST 381-2]
060e2b34.0101010e.04010606.010a0000 [AVC profile, ST 381-3]
060e2b34.0101010e.04010606.010d0000 [AVC level, ST 381-3]

This Test depends on the wrapped video codec:
- for MPEG-2 in MXF: "Profile And Level" is signalled in one metadata element, e.g. "130" (= 422P@HL).
- for AVC in MXF there are two metadata elements: "AVC Profile" signals e.g. 122 ( = High 4:2:2 Intra) "AVC Levels" signals e.g. 41 ( = Level 4.1). If only one metadata element can be detected, the Check Result shall be false.

For MPEG-2 in MXF the value shall be identical with the "profile_and_level_indication" in the MPEG-2 sequence header extension.
For AVC in MXF the value shall be identical with "profile_idc" and "level_idc" in the sequence parameter set.
